Can pie be divided?

Envy-free division. An EF division of a pie can always be found using divide and choose: one partner cuts the pie into two sectors he considers equal, and the other partner chooses the sector that he considers better. But for a pie, better divisions may be possible.

How many pieces are there in a pie?

If the pie is heftier or filled with dense filling, you may want to go for eight pieces. Otherwise, six slices is standard for most 9-inch pies. For pan pies, like our favorite sweet and savory slab pies, you can get 12 pieces per dish.

How do you calculate a pie chart?

The pie diagram formula is given as = ( given data / total value of data ) x 360. Pie Chart Definition: A type of graph in which a circle is divided into sectors that represent a proportion of the whole.

What size is a pie pan?

The best pie pan is the right size Yes, some pie recipes call for a 10” pan, others for an 8”, but the vast majority of pie recipes direct you to a 9”-diameter pan.
